Our Story
PAGSA exists to represent and serve the graduate students in the School of Public and other graduate students enrolled (degree and non-degree) in public administration courses.
PAGSA also works with other graduate and professional programs through the Graduate and Professional Student Association (GPSA). Our PAGSA representatives work with students from other programs to create and pass legislation that focuses on problems affecting graduate students.
